0.25/0.5 No-Limit Hold'em (5 handed)
Hand recorder used for this poker hand: PokerStrategy Elephant 0.67 by www.pokerstrategy.com.

Preflop: Hero is BU with K♦, Q♦
MP3 folds, CO raises to $1.75, Hero raises to $5.50, 2 folds, CO calls $3.75.

Flop: ($11.75) 6♦, 9♥, T♣ (2 players)
CO bets $11.75, Hero calls $11.75.

Turn: ($35.25) Q♥ (2 players)
CO bets $35.25, Hero raises to $34.24 (All-In).

River: ($104.74) 7♥ (1 players)

Final Pot: $104.74

call flop? villian was spewy and likes to bet with nothing, I had 2 overcards, gutshot and backdoor FD, and his line didnt even make sense

If I know he is betting air and can still fold a lot I am simply shipping the flop. Calling doesn't make too much sense.
